Hello, this is v3 of the series, the only change is a rebase to a newer mainline tree (didn't check if this resulted in any changes, worked without problems) and I added commit logs and sign-offs.
So the open issues still apply which I list here again: - no device tree binding doc for bus master driver (patch 2) I will clean this up eventually when (and if) patch 1 gets in. - the devices should be polled each 25 ms, otherwise a per-device watchdog resets the device. I'm currently using a workqueue for that, and on a loaded machine sometimes the watchdog triggers. So maybe I need a different approach here? But I didn't debug that yet, so this is just FYI. Patches 2 and 3 are only to show how patch 1 is intended to be used and I'd need to rework patch 2 before it can go in and patch 3 probably needs to go via the gpio tree, but I didn't care to cc the right people as this series is mainly about patch 1.
